Popular Diamonds Cuts For An Engagement Ring



A diamond ring is one of the most sought after option for an engagement ring. It has this sparkle and beauty that no person could resist. If you want a ring that’s truly beautiful, you would want to consider the cut of the diamond. The cut of the diamond is one of the factors that affect the sparkle of the diamond.

 

In this article, we will share to you the most popular diamond cuts. If you’re looking for the perfect engagement ring, it would be ideal to choose a diamond ring with the following cuts:


 

Round Brilliant Diamonds

 

Round brilliant diamonds are the most popular cut for an engagement ring. It has been a classic choice for majority of couples around the globe. The diamond sparkles well since its rounded shape maximizes how light is reflected on it. Check out a selection of engagement rings from your favourite jeweller and you’ll be surprised seeing that most of it have round brilliant cut diamonds.


 

Princess Cut Diamonds

 

Rings with princess cut diamonds are among the popular options. The Princess cut diamond has a square or rectangular side which allows it to be suitable for any ring style. It can easily be set in the ring making it such a versatile cut among others.


 

Marquise Cut Diamonds

 

Marquise cut diamonds have curved sides and pointed ends. It is sometimes compared with a football. It is a popular choice because it gives an illusion of a large sized diamond.  It’s long and narrow shape also makes the finger appear longer.


 

Emerald Cut Diamonds

 

Emerald cut diamonds have a rectangular, table-like shape. This is an ideal choice for women who like vintage and Art Deco styles of jewellery. Because of its shape, it reflects light in an elegant way.

 



Cushion Cut Diamonds

 

Cushion cut diamonds are often compared with a pillow hence its name. Cushion cut is a square shaped diamond with rounded corners. Such cut can be perfect for halo style rings.
